Not at all, well horrendous was a bit over it I think, I am playing at 1080p all Epic DLSS quality and game looks excellent, outstanding graphics, these distortions in the screenshots are due to the effects applied on the gas mask hud, like condition of the gas mask (clean, used, dirty, weathered, damaged), glass tint, glass condensing (breathing and/or condensation), head motion, etc…
These are options you may choose to apply or not during gameplay for additional immersion.
https://www.nexusmods.com/stalker2heartofchornobyl/mods/930
There is currently no dynamic solution that will change the effects according to the headgear you select, the damage it suffers, player breathing rate and the environment you are at, like we had in some mods for SoC, CS, CoP and CoC, as Smurth’s Dynamic Hud ( https://imgur.com/a/gxZNKsi ) so you need to select it manually if you want.
If the player does not like gas mask, only NVG can be applied of course without any distortion, graphics will remain the same only with the crispy NVG.
